    Folic acid is also known as folate. It is a water soluble form of vitamin B9. Serious birth defects are prevented if it is taken during or before pregnancy. However, if conception is being planned by a woman or if it is found that she is pregnant, then it is very essential that she increases the intake of folic acid. This should be increased at least up to 400 mcg. According to the centers for disease control and prevention, if a woman takes folic acid on a daily basis, she can surely prevent 70 percent of the spine, neural tube and brain defects. Given below are the benefits of folic acid during pregnancy

    Normal cellular development of the unborn baby is facilitated by folic acid. This is not realized by many women. However, there is great importance of regular folic intake during and before pregnancy. According to various studies, women who do not consume folic acid or are deficient in folic acid have very high risks of giving birth to a premature baby.


    • The risk of cleft palate or cleft lip is minimized due to folic acid. This is a birth defect due to which the upper roof or the part of the mouth is affected
    • he risk of heart defects in the baby are minimized
    • Moreover, a quick and a healthy growth pattern is facilitated for the fetus and the placenta. If there is lack or absence of folic acid, the fetal growth and the cell division can be impaired.
    • An important role is played by the Folic acid in the production of DNA. These are the extra blood cells that are needed during pregnancy. Sometimes, they are needed for preventing the neural tube defects.
    • The proper formation of hemoglobin is also facilitated by folic acid
    • The possible risks of heart attack, Alzheimer’s disease, cancer and stroke are also prevented
    • The complications and the pain for both the mother and the baby can be prevented due to this simple vitamin. This is among the important benefits of folic acid during pregnancy


    The occurrence of birth defects is usually found in the first 4 weeks of pregnancy. However, pregnancy cannot be figured out by women in the first few weeks. Therefore, the required amount of folic acid is not consumed by them. it is essential for women to talk to their obstetricians and find out the quantity of folate that is required for them. Thus, one must never forget the benefits of folic acid during pregnancy.
